Erw Wen Road is in Colwyn Bay and in Colwyn district. LL29 7SD is located in the Glyn elect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Clwyd West.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Safety

Is Erw Wen Road d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Erw Wen Road was 209.5 per 1,000 residents, which is 116.8% higher than the Eirias average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.

Erw Wen Road has the 9th highest crime rate of 45 local areas in Eirias and the 42nd highest crime rate of 383 local areas in Conwy .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 135.7 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been rising year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-38.1%.
